I recently purchased Corel VideoStudio X7 Ultimate. I turned on the Screen Capture and noticed 60FPS wasn't an option for recording. Is there anyway to make 60FPS possible on it because I am sure I've seen someone record with 60FPS with that program. If not, what happens when I export it to 60FPS? Is it upscaled or is it then same thing? Thanks for your time :)

I don't know of any way to change that setting -- or indeed the format, which seems fixed at .wmv... However, I would be happy to learn if anyone else has found a way.

But capturing at 30 fps and later upscaling that to 60 fps will serve little purpose. In the first place you can't make a video better by just changing the frame rate. But more importantly, upscaling is done by simply repeating each frame. This could produce rather jerky output, particularly if fast action is involved in the video...
